I work in the construction industry and have been forced to compete with Mexican framing crews. The way it typically works is that a Mexican contractor comes in with legal authority to do so (he has a SS # and all that). Almost his entire crew is illegal. All payments from the general contractor are made to him and he in turn pays his crew, IN CASH!! They send the money back home, he files taxes and claims the money he has paid them as deductions, however he does not use 1099's as are "technically" required. The payments to his men are then untraceable unless he is audited and asked for proof of who he made the payments to. If that is the case, he has several options: He can go through the audit and "owe" the IRS money if he loses. He can also go back to Mexico and later re-enter under another identity. He can also allow one of his fellow country-men to be the new paymaster and basically "disappear" from IRS records. American contractors who pay taxes and cannot run or hide from the IRS have to compete with this. I don't imagine that too many people who hire illegal domestics bother to get employer identification numbers.

Most domestics are paid cash & are not a 'business' expense because they aren't hired by businesses; they are hired by home owners. And I bet as many citizens as illegals who are domestics are paid under the table as well by house holders who want to avoid paying taxes.

As a 32 yr Social Security employee I only took 1 application for benefits filed by a person who worked as a domestic and she was a citizen! Which means that there aren't a whole lot of domestics anywhere in the US whose wages are being properly reported -- it doesn't just apply to illegals.
